Robot Welding Route Planning in Car-Body Welding Process Based on Genetic Algorithm

摘要

A genetic algorithm combined with graph theory was proposed for solving the problem of welding route planning in car body-in-white manufacture.By regarding the welding point and tool center point frame as spatial point to establish relationship graph,transforming constraint factors into directed relationship matrix and using minimum motion distance of welding gun as object function,a traveling salesperson problem model was established.Generation of legal initial population and processing of selection,cross and mutation genetic operators were based on directed relationship matrix.MATLAB language was used to program.Taking the welding route planning of the deck lid repair welding station as example,planning result shows that welding route is reasonable and this scheme has been implemented successfully in engineering.
